    Can I install a toilet with 12
    My flange bolts are 11-3/8" from the wall. can I use a toilet with a 12" base

    Hi DDclick...

    Yes, a 12" rough in toilet should fit perfectly with a 11 3/8" rough in. Here, toilets with a 12" rough usually have between 1-3" between the toilet tank and the finished wall after installation. At 11 3/8" it could be close or the toilet tank could still be up to 2.5" off the finished wall! You should be all set!

    Out in them field we rough our toilets in at 12" to center. With the finished wall that will give you about a 11 1/2" set.
    You'll be just fine. Good luck, Tom
